MassHighway has informed us
that their contractor, JF White,
will begin several evenings
of night work on Tuesday, February
6th from 10:00 PM - 6:00 AM.
- This work could last for
up to three weeks, from Monday
through Friday nights (not
on weekends or holidays).
We'll continue to discuss
the duration of this work
with MassHighway and keep
neighbors informed.
- Massachusetts Bay Commuter
Rail has flagmen immediately
available for this work who
are necessary to ensure this
work is completed safely.
- This work involves attaching
shielding on the underside
of the bridge to keep debris
from falling on the train
tracks. The work will utilize
a man-lift, power tools for
sawing and attaching the wood,
and a generator.
- During this time the temporary
pedestrian bridge will also
be lifted into place at night
(provided utility work proceeds
on schedule) so that final
electric and gas utility connections
can be made by Nstar onto
the temporary bridge.
